Article 378 covers which type of raceway?

Explanation:
Article 378 of the National Electrical Code (NEC) specifically addresses Nonmetallic Wireways. Nonmetallic wireways are used for the protection and routing of electrical conductors and are designed to help organize wiring in a clean and efficient manner. This article outlines the requirements for installation, materials, and construction standards for these types of raceways. Nonmetallic wireways are advantageous because they are lightweight, corrosion-resistant, and can be more aesthetically pleasing compared to their metal counterparts. Additionally, they do not conduct electricity, offering an extra layer of safety in various applications. Understanding the standards set forth in this article is essential for anyone working with these raceways to ensure safety and compliance with electrical codes.

Exam Format

The NEC Articles Test typically consists of multiple-choice questions designed to assess your understanding of the NEC's provisions, interpretation, and its practical applications. Here’s what you can expect:

  • Number of Questions: Generally, there are about 100 questions.
  • Type of Questions: Multiple-choice questions with four options.
  • Time Limit: 2-3 hours to complete the test, depending on the specific requirements by your testing entity.
  • Passing Score: A pass mark may vary but is usually around 70-75%.

The questions are structured to challenge your comprehension of the NEC code, and you need to navigate the codebook to find the answers efficiently.

How often is the NEC exam updated?

The National Electrical Code is updated every three years, with the next significant update scheduled for 2025. Staying current with these changes is vital for electrical professionals, as it directly impacts safety regulations and industry standards, making consistent study essential for ongoing success.
